DATA LINK COMMUNICATIONS DESCRIPTION AND OPERATION
Circuit Description
The data link connector (DLC) allows a scan tool to communicate with the class 2 serial data line. The serial
data line is the means by which the microprocessor-controlled modules in the vehicle communicate with each
other. Once the scan tool is connected to the class 2 serial data line through the DLC, the scan tool can be used
to monitor each module for diagnostic purposes and to check for diagnostic trouble codes (DTCs). Class 2 serial
data is transmitted on a single wire at an average of 10.4 kbps. This value is an average, class 2 uses a variable
